Special Temporary Authority application - Initial values - Purpose of Operation
Please explain the purpose of operation:
The additional time in orbit will be in direct support of the SEOPS LLC Lynk Payload. The conditions stated in the Exhibit are accepted by the licensee. Telemetry links include: 1) S-Band Single Access (SSA) and S-Band Multiple Access (SMA) spread spectrum return link operation with NASA TDRS. 2) High data rate downlink operation with mission Ground Stations 3) A Cygnus to ISS link for proximity operations will be used during the mission. The transmitters supporting these links are described below: The Cygnus spacecraft configuration will comprise of two L-3 Cincinnati Electronics (L-3 CE) transmitters (primary & redundant-backup) operating at 2287.5 MHz in TDRS mode and it will also provide telemetry downlinks at 3 Mbps and 6 Mbps. Two additional transmitters (primary & redundant-backup), also procured from L-3 CE, operating at 2203.2 MHz will be used for the Cygnus to ISS proximity communication link. These transmitters will meet all STA parameters and conditions as compiled with previous CRS STA applications.
